Modifications to guidelines governing actions of agencies are described by which term?

Explanation:
The main idea here is that guidelines directing how an agency should act are part of its policy framework. When those guidelines are updated or altered, what has happened is a change in policy. This reflects a shift in how the agency is supposed to operate in practice without changing the underlying legal statutes. A change in law would involve formal legislation and statutory rules, not simply updating internal guidelines. Campaigns for change refer to efforts to persuade others to adopt new policies or laws, rather than the actual modification of guidelines. Media effectiveness concerns how well media influences policy, not the act of modifying guidelines.
